Lucent Study Estimates $10 Billion Market for IMS

Lucent Technologies estimates that U.S. service providers can tap a market potentially worth almost $10 billion a year by offering personalized services that blend voice and data applications across fixed and mobile networks, according a study conducted by the firm.

Lucent’s research, conducted last year, involved 1,250 men and women, ages 15 and over — 650 for the business survey and 600 for the consumer survey. The types of services covered in the survey were culled from focus groups. Survey questions were designed to determine which features were most valuable to people and the effect of various capabilities and pricing on demand.

Lucent said it launched the study to help the company and its service provider customers understand and evaluate the market for the personal services that can be enabled by an IP Multimedia Subsystem (IMS)-based network.

The converged services market estimate is based on a projected offering of several bundles of services customized to fit the needs of specific market segments identified in the research and priced at $10 to $35 a month. The pricing and the projected take rates were derived from a combination of survey responses from 1,250 people and related business modeling.

Lucent’s research indicates that the types of applications that have the greatest value, depending upon the segment, are those that offer integrated communications, rapid real-time response that enables impromptu conversations and spontaneous collaboration capability.
